The heart is heavy and the snow is heavy, and the feedback is late.

Feeding back means that when an old crow is old and can't fly, a little crow feeds her mother with food, just like a mother bird feeds a bird. So it is called "feedback". Now it is used to describe "repaying parents".

So this is a poem about going home during the Spring Festival: this heavy snow has hindered my trip, and I am afraid that I will delay going home and I will not be able to repay my parents' kindness!
